aboutsummaryrefslogtreecommitdiffstats
path: root/mail
diff options
context:
space:
mode:
authorMatthew Barnes <mbarnes@redhat.com>2010-05-31 11:03:41 +0800
committerMatthew Barnes <mbarnes@redhat.com>2010-05-31 11:05:14 +0800
commit6640519e4863961fa146fbc198709986dc5bb902 (patch)
treed22fd3dd028c19c060f1989f552a12a0412e98a2 /mail
parentfb880ceb4f95bce331fe49b26bba5eec0757f07f (diff)
downloadgsoc2013-evolution-6640519e4863961fa146fbc198709986dc5bb902.tar
gsoc2013-evolution-6640519e4863961fa146fbc198709986dc5bb902.tar.gz
gsoc2013-evolution-6640519e4863961fa146fbc198709986dc5bb902.tar.bz2
gsoc2013-evolution-6640519e4863961fa146fbc198709986dc5bb902.tar.lz
gsoc2013-evolution-6640519e4863961fa146fbc198709986dc5bb902.tar.xz
gsoc2013-evolution-6640519e4863961fa146fbc198709986dc5bb902.tar.zst
gsoc2013-evolution-6640519e4863961fa146fbc198709986dc5bb902.zip
Use EWebView functions whenever possible.
Diffstat (limited to 'mail')
-rw-r--r--mail/e-mail-reader-utils.c5
1 files changed, 4 insertions, 1 deletions
diff --git a/mail/e-mail-reader-utils.c b/mail/e-mail-reader-utils.c
index 3282af34af..9d798d92c9 100644
--- a/mail/e-mail-reader-utils.c
+++ b/mail/e-mail-reader-utils.c
@@ -30,6 +30,7 @@
#include "e-util/e-alert-dialog.h"
#include "filter/e-filter-rule.h"
+#include "misc/e-web-view.h"
#include "mail/e-mail-browser.h"
#include "mail/em-composer-utils.h"
@@ -358,6 +359,7 @@ e_mail_reader_reply_to_message (EMailReader *reader,
CamelMimeMessage *new_message;
CamelMimeMessage *src_message;
CamelFolder *folder;
+ EWebView *web_view;
GtkHTML *html;
struct _camel_header_raw *header;
const gchar *uid;
@@ -372,6 +374,7 @@ e_mail_reader_reply_to_message (EMailReader *reader,
html_display = e_mail_reader_get_html_display (reader);
html = ((EMFormatHTML *) html_display)->html;
+ web_view = E_WEB_VIEW (html);
folder = e_mail_reader_get_folder (reader);
message_list = e_mail_reader_get_message_list (reader);
@@ -379,7 +382,7 @@ e_mail_reader_reply_to_message (EMailReader *reader,
uid = MESSAGE_LIST (message_list)->cursor_uid;
g_return_if_fail (uid != NULL);
- if (!gtk_html_command (html, "is-selection-active"))
+ if (!e_web_view_is_selection_active (web_view))
goto whole_message;
selection = gtk_html_get_selection_html (html, &length);